Common Welding Certificates

Although the AWS’ normal CW card paves the way for the majority of employment opportunities, many fields require their own certain certification. Several of the most-widely used of these appear below.

  • SCWI and CWI Certification for inspectors and senior inspectors
  • American Petroleum Institute Certification for welders who deal with pipelines in the gas and oil field
  • CW Certificates to be a Certified Welder
  • ASME Certification for individuals that work on boiler and pressure containers

Things You Should Know in Welding Specialist Training

There are actually quite a few fantastic welding schools all around the nation, however you should know which of the certified welding schools represent the right option. You might be told that welding programs are all exactly the same, however there are some issues you really should be aware of before deciding on which welding programs to sign up for in Cote Corner, ME. One of the first details you really should determine is whether or not the class continues to be accredited by the AWS. If your training program is accredited by these organizations, you ought to also look at some other features like:

  • Make sure that the college’s curriculum offers courses in pipe welding, GTAW, GMAW, and SMAW
  • Look for courses that comply with AWS SENSE standards
  • Determine if the college supplies financial support
  • Be certain the program trains on machinery that matches up-to-date trade specifications
